Restaurant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water spill | Yes | No | DIY is fine for small spills, but for larger spills, it’s best to call a professional to prevent further damage and ensure thorough drying. |
| Water damage to electrical systems | No | Yes | Water damage to electrical systems can be hazardous and needs professional attention to ensure safety and prevent further damage. |
| Visible mold growth | No | Yes | Mold growth needs professional attention to ensure thorough removal and prevent further growth. |
| Discolored or warped flooring | No | Yes | Discolored or warped flooring needs professional attention to ensure thorough repair and prevent further damage. |
| Water damage to structural elements | No | Yes | Water damage to structural elements needs professional attention to ensure safety and prevent further damage. |
| Unpleasant odors or musty smells | No | Yes | Unpleasant odors or musty smells need professional attention to ensure thorough cleaning and removal of mold and bacteria. |

Restaurant Water Damage Restoration Cost in Elyria, OH
The cost of restaurant water damage restoration in Elyria, OH, varies based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and the local conditions. Our prices start at around $500 and can go up to $2,500 or more, depending on the scope of the project. What affects the cost includes the type and extent of the damage, the materials and equipment needed, and the labor costs.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$1,500 | The type and extent of the damage, and the equipment needed. |
| Water damage assessment | $200 – $500 | The complexity of the damage and the time required for assessment. |
| Structural repair and reconstruction | $1,000 – $3,000 | The extent of the damage and the materials and labor needed. |
| Moisture detection and removal | $300 – $900 | The type and extent of the damage, and the equipment needed. |
| Disinfection and cleaning | $200 – $500 | The type and extent of the damage, and the equipment needed. |
